Receptacle Dummy Connector
An item specifically designed to mate with a plug connector to perform one or more special functions, such as to support a plug connector when not in use, short contacts, or open or close electrical circuits, in or on another connector. It does not have provisions for attaching a wire, cable, or contact. It is designed to mount on a panel, bulkhead, wall, or chassis. It does not include connector shells which are merely used to position a plug connector on a panel.
